Skip to content

Commit 001cb40

Browse files
authored
Merge pull request #2440 from Haehnchen/feature/ServiceArgumentSelectionDialog-acces
fix init state for service selection dialog
2 parents d166e04 + 338a9bd commit 001cb40

File tree

1 file changed

+3
-2
lines changed

1 file changed

+3
-2
lines changed

src/main/java/fr/adrienbrault/idea/symfony2plugin/action/ui/ServiceArgumentSelectionDialog.java

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-20,6 +20,7 @@
2020
import java.awt.*;
2121
import java.awt.event.KeyEvent;
2222
import java.util.ArrayList;
23+
import java.util.HashMap;
2324
import java.util.Map;
2425
import java.util.Set;
2526

@@ -29,7 +30,7 @@
2930
public class ServiceArgumentSelectionDialog extends JDialog {
3031

3132
private final Project project;
32-
private final Map<String, Set<String>> arguments;
33+
private final Map<String, Set<String>> arguments = new HashMap<>();
3334
private final Callback callback;
3435
private JPanel panel1;
3536
private JButton generateButton;
@@ -41,7 +42,7 @@ public class ServiceArgumentSelectionDialog extends JDialog {
4142

4243
public ServiceArgumentSelectionDialog(Project project, Map<String, Set<String>> arguments, Callback callback) {
4344
this.project = project;
44-
this.arguments = arguments;
45+
this.arguments.putAll(arguments);
4546
this.callback = callback;
4647
}
4748

0 commit comments

Comments
 (0)